Faulty cable causes power failure

Hundreds of businesses and homes in north Liverpool are without electricity following a power shortage.

According to Scottish Power between 800 and 1,000 customers have been affected by a fault on an underground high voltage cable.

The fault, which the firm says involves general wear and tear, was reported just before midnight and has resulted in power cuts or flickering lights.

Engineers expect to have the fault repaired by mid-afternoon.
